  • Patent number: 11083738
    Abstract: Provided herein are dietary supplement compositions comprising a plurality of beadlets and an oil. Provided herein are also dietary supplement compositions comprising a plurality of mini-tabs and oil. The beadlets or mini-tabs comprise at least one nutrient that is miscible in aqueous solution, and the oil comprises at least one fat-soluble nutrient. The composition may be contained within one or more capsules, and be packaged with a scented insert.

  • Patent number: 5985665
    Abstract: The present invention provides a cell culture medium useful for a biochemical analysis of antioxidant function in human lymphocytes, said medium comprising, a buffered, serum-free solution containing the following ingredients: a carbohydrate selected from the group consisting of glucose and a compound biologically capable of producing glucose in the cells, a biologically usable form of pantothenic acid, choline or a biological usable form of a substance capable of producing choline in the cells, inorganic ions comprising chloride, phosphate, calcium, magnesium, potassium, sodium, and iron in a biologically utilizable form, cumene hydroperoxide, deionized water, and a mitogen in an amount effective to stimulate the lymphocytes being assayed; said buffered, serum-free solution having a pH from about 6.8 to 7.6, said cell culture medium characterized by being effective to determine nutritional deficiencies, inadequacies, and imbalances and to biochemically analyze antioxidant function of the lymphocytes.
